The Phoenix Contact PCB header integrates advanced connectivity with a compact design, making it an ideal choice for various electronic applications. Engineered for reliability, it supports a nominal current of 5 A and a rated voltage of 160 V, ensuring robust performance in demanding environments. The connector features a linear pinning layout and is compatible with wave soldering, simplifying assembly processes. Its intuitive snap-in locking mechanism enhances user experience by preventing accidental disconnection while enabling quick and easy module replacement. With excellent material specifications, including RoHS compliance and superior flammability ratings, this product stands out for its safety and durability in diverse applications.
